and will is coming along on banjo #4
it's an interesting combination of part fretless at the top end of the fretboard where the iontonation is easier and fretted at the pot ens where precision is more important ...
and, this time, because of the way he's doing the fret board with no binding, he bought a .023 router bit .... yeah that is less than 1/32nd of an inch, and is exactly the size of the 't' on the fret wire ... so, he was able to cut the stopped slots on the cnc and the edges of the fretboard will be very cool ... more on that when the fretting is finished ... he's got his own banjo website up now ...

and, we started a new bed project .. it will have a pair of slabs hung on the wall for a headboard,the platform attached to that 6" up from the floor, and a box with a drawer on either side at the top of the mattress ... king size .. cool concept ...
this is a photoshopped slab arrangement .. we'll start smoothing and joing them tomorrow ...
